]> git.ipfire.org Git - thirdparty/qemu.git/commit
qga/installer: Remove QGA VSS if QGA installation failed
authorKostiantyn Kostiuk <kkostiuk@redhat.com>
Mon, 25 Aug 2025 14:31:55 +0000 (17:31 +0300)
committerKostiantyn Kostiuk <kkostiuk@redhat.com>
Mon, 1 Sep 2025 11:02:18 +0000 (14:02 +0300)
commit85ff0e956bf26a93c92e4dca8f6257613269a0cf
treeb85553c2c0218de51c34f469fe1a8c9a0cd99725
parentedf3780a7dad4658ab7b72ea37e310a2be9b16d3
qga/installer: Remove QGA VSS if QGA installation failed

When QGA Installer failed to install QGA service but install
QGA VSS provider, provider should be removed before installer
exits. Otherwise QGA VSS will has broken infomation and
prevent QGA installation in next run.

Reviewed-by: Yan Vugenfirer <yvugenfi@redhat.com>
Link: https://lore.kernel.org/qemu-devel/20250825143155.160913-1-kkostiuk@redhat.com
Signed-off-by: Kostiantyn Kostiuk <kkostiuk@redhat.com>
qga/installer/qemu-ga.wxs